Speaker's Virtues Appeal

Does the speaker appeal to any of the following virtues: wisdom, temperance, courage, or justice (see brief descriptions below)? If so, how? Cite the words in the speech that prove your point. Would Plato think the speech was ethical or just a cave of shadows?

1. Wisdom: be wise, carefully consider your course of action, use your reason, reflect on the issue, and make a good decision.

2. Temperance: consider both sides, be moderate, and restrain emotions regarding the issue.

3. Courage: don't be afraid, resist impulses that keep you from doing the right thing under difficult circumstances - or have the courage to check the desire to do something foolhardy.

4. Justice: fairness, giving to every person what they are due.
